The Hot Seat

From TALKING POINTS MEMO:

The resignation of scandal-plagued Sen. John Ensign (R-NV), and the expected appointment of current Republican candidate Rep. Dean Heller to the seat, could portend a political mess of a wholly different sort: A special election for Heller’s House seat — and the conundrum for Republicans posed by the potential candidacy of their losing U.S. Senate nominee from 2010, Sharron Angle.

Angle, who lost the 2010 Senate race despite the national Republican wave — due to controversy over extreme statements about “Second Amendment remedies” to Democratic policies, and her statements in favor of phasing out Social Security and Medicare — has already been running for the House seat, along with retired Navy Commander Kirk Lippold, who was chief officer of the U.S.S. Cole when it was attacked by al Qaeda in 2000. In addition, Lt. Gov. Brian Krolicki and state GOP chair Mark Amodei are reportedly considering the race.

Cindy Hampton Isn’t the Only One John Ensign Screwed!

From 8NEWSNOW:

LAS VEGAS — The pieces continue to fall into place for a political shake up like Nevada has never seen.

Senator John Ensign is stepping down, Congressman Dean Heller may take his place and the chain reaction is now uncharted territory that could cost the state hundreds of thousands of dollars.

Governor Brian Sandoval said Friday he will name a replacement for Ensign before May 3rd. If Heller is the selection, as has been expected, state leaders actually have no idea of what exactly to do next.
